This a poem is from about this time last year(May). Today is only the second day of another enforced “Lockdown” , but I feel like I have been flattened by a slow moving Council steamroller … I cannot write a poem today, so this old piece will have to do !!
Weariness
I am not one, to feel depressed
This is more an aura, of been oppressed
Bones are aching
Muscles are throbbing
And I feel like I have run a marathon
But I have hardly ventured out into the fray
Here I am in isolation
Wondering about the sun’s X-rays
I am not one, to feel depressed
This is more an aura, of been oppressed
I have a thumping headache
My misty eyes are tired
And I feel like I have rewritten the Bible
But I have only been writing a poem a day
Here I am in isolation
Wondering about my future’s stairway
Ivor Steven (c) May 2020
